It was developed for PCR and other high temperature applications due to its effectiveness in preventing sample evaporation. The PCR Foil Seal is pierceable; when pierced, the foil tears in an irregular manner which prevents the formation of a vacuum. It also has perforated end tabs for easy application and removal by peeling. For all adhesive seals, the best sealing results are achieved using the hand held Adhesive Seal Roller (4ti-0502). This semi-skirted low profile plate is recommended for use with ABI® Fast block thermal cyclers. The low profile wells of this plate are shorter than "standard" profile wells, which decrease the "dead space" between the heated lid of the thermal cycler and the sample in the well. This eliminates condensation forming on the side wall of the tubes, preventing reduction in PCR volume and increasing the efficiency of the reaction. This is especially recommended for reaction volumes below 20μl. The rigid polycarbonate skirt of this design eliminates warping and distortion during PCR, and makes it ideal for use with robotic systems. Its skirt also allows for labeling or barcoding.
